The Benefits of Regular Pruning
Scheduled pruning goes beyond improving visual appeal-it decreases structural issues, clears diseased or crossing branches, and improves wind-load distribution to reduce potential damage during storms. You'll also maintain clearance over structures, sidewalks, and service lines, minimizing contact points that cause abrasion and decay. Appropriate canopy thinning enhances light and air flow, lowering leaf wetness duration and presence of foliar pathogens. Correct branch spacing and selective cuts support stronger attachment angles, preventing co-dominant stems and future splitting. Timing matters: prune during dormancy or after peak growth flush to minimize stress and pest attraction. Implement ANSI A300 standards and well-maintained, sanitized tools to produce small, clean wounds outside the branch collar. With regular intervals, you prolong service life, maintain form, and prevent costly emergency interventions.
Hazard Evaluation Protocols
Pruning establishes the framework; hazard assessment confirms that framework functions reliably under everyday stress. You initiate with a comprehensive inspection checklist: botanical identification, trunk size, tree form, defects (splits, voids, competing leaders), root plate condition, tilt degree, and activity zone underneath. You record using pictures, trunk measurements, and percussion tests. For high-value sites, you incorporate decay detection equipment to measure wood deterioration and evaluate structural integrity.
Following this, you utilize a risk matrix that integrates risk probability with potential consequences, considering Sarasota's weather patterns and soil characteristics. You subsequently outline risk reduction strategies: canopy reduction measurements, cabling/bracing specs (ANSI A300), pruning for utility clearance, or complete removal for unacceptable risk levels. Lastly, you plan follow-up inspection schedules corresponding to vegetation development and weather cycles.

Evaluating Tree Risks
Despite a tree's healthy appearance, particular indicators can signal significant hazards and possible structural failure. Start by examining the base: watch for soil uplift, recent ground swelling, or visible root damage-common following development activities or intense weather events. Check the root flare for rot and watch for fungal bodies or off-putting scents. Survey the trunk for new bark splits, leaking sap, or sudden angle changes after significant rain.
Inspect the tree crown with restricted visibility by utilizing binoculars at different viewpoints and different times of day. Browned leaves out of season, sparse foliage, or numerous dead twigs indicate tree stress. Watch for canopy dieback after irrigation modifications or exposure to salt. Document results, capture images of changes, and schedule a certified arborist's Level 2 visual inspection, particularly before the hurricane season.
Overview of Structural Defects
While trees can appear strong, hidden structural issues can mask critical weaknesses that increase the chance of collapse during wind, rain, or soil saturation. Watch for tightly joined codominant branches, bark inclusions, and structural splits. Hollow cavities, longitudinal splits, and excessive leans point to unstable support. Within the canopy, dying branches indicate overall health issues or circulation disruption. At the root collar, irregular buttress roots, decay bodies, and soil displacement suggest root deterioration or foundation instability. Dead or loose bark, sap flow, and pruning wounds often hide deterioration. Storm-prone Sarasota soils and intermittent flooding worsen defects by reducing root anchorage and increasing stress on damaged stems. Document all issues, evaluate threatened objects below branches, and schedule assessments after major storms.

Professional Pruning, Trimming Strategies, and Growth Maintenance
Since appropriate pruning defines form and minimizes hazards, you approach precision pruning with defined targets, appropriate scheduling, and accurate execution. You identify target branches at the bark ridge and branch collar, then perform three-cut removals to stop tearing. You focus on crown balancing to distribute weight and optimize wind handling, using selective thinning to minimize density without excessive interior clearing. You maintain scaffold hierarchy, keep 30-45% live crown ratio on shade trees, and acknowledge species-specific responses common in live oak, sable palm, and laurel oak of Sarasota.
Schedule pruning during dormancy or after flush hardening to minimize stress, ensuring sanitized tools between trees, and keeping annual canopy removal to 20-25%. Avoid topping, flush cuts, and excessive raise-pruning that creates weak sprouts. Keep track of defects, track regrowth, and establish maintenance intervals.
Professional Tree Removal and Stump Grinding Guidelines
When removal becomes necessary, you move forward with a safety-first approach: perform a comprehensive risk assessment (evaluating targets, lean, defects, decay class), confirm species-specific failure patterns common in Sarasota winds, and determine drop zones and exclusion perimeters. Pick the technique - crane, rigging, or sectional dismantling - based on load paths, tie-in points, and canopy weight distribution. Implement pre-job briefings to align roles, hand signals, and escape routes. Prioritize crew training in chainsaw handling, aerial lift rescue, and rigging physics. Require PPE: safety helmet, hearing/eye protection, protective chaps and ANSI Z133-compliant climbing systems. Plan equipment maintenance; check ropes, carabiners, saw chain tension, and hydraulic lines prior to cutting. For stump grinding, mark utilities, install shields, control chips, and verify proper backfill and grade.
Important Permits, Regulations, and Insurance to Verify
Prior to conducting tree operations in Sarasota, there are important rules to consider, so be sure to confirm proper authorizations, conservation status of species, and right-of-way limitations before beginning work. Initially verify permits through Sarasota County's ePermit system or your municipal authority; document tree species, trunk diameter at breast height, and location relative to setbacks or coastal zones. Check for qualifying exemptions (including urgent risk verified by an arborist) prior to starting work. Check Florida's protected and invasive species listings to prevent infractions.
Validate the contractor's license and OSHA certification. Obtain written insurance documentation: active general liability (tree-specific), workers' compensation, and commercial auto coverage. Make sure certificates get provided straight from the insurance company with you listed as certificate holder and confirming insurance limits and policy endorsements (CG 20 10/20 37 where applicable). Check utility line clearances with 811 and obtain HOA approvals if needed.
